Kanye Feeling 'Stronger' at Surprise Gig

PETA would not have approved of Kanye's surprise set at Flavorpill mag's One Step Beyond party at Manhattan's American Museum of Natural History's Rose Center for Earth and Space planetarium on Friday (for full gallery click here!). His nanna might be pissed that he took her mink out of cold storage for the sneaky appearance, too.

"You look like my grandma," joked Chi-town's favorite Pro Nails–sporting party rapper Kid Sister, whom Kanye showed up to support Friday (he's in her video for "Pro Nails," too)—also, his dead animal garb was riddled with more gaping holes than 50 Cent's torso (photo evidence after the jump).

Maybe Kid Sis was feeling a bit upstaged after a 15-minute so-so set of her own. As she wrapped (rapped?) the last song, the crowd suddenly surged toward the stage and Mr. West appeared for five or six abbreviated versions of songs, including "Good Life," "Can't Tell Me Nothing," and, of course, the Flavorpill crowd-friendly Daft Punk karaoke number "Stronger," or as Kanye put it, "the one y'all been waiting for." (Rainbow-bright hip-hop duo Cool Kids played earlier in the evening, too.) It's one of the first surprise appearances stateside for West following the November 10 death of his mother, Donda, but he bobbed and danced and seemed as cocksure as ever. Left to keep the full planetarium dancing for the remainder of the evening, Kanye's DJ A-Trak, muttered on mic, "Well ... how do you follow that?"

Duh, laser Floyd!
